title = "Measurement of plasma procyanidin B-2 and procyanidin B-3 levels after oral administration in rat",
abstract = "Using a high-performance liquid chromatographic method and mass spectrometry analysis, we successfully measured the absorption of orally administered procyanidin B-2 and procyanidin B-3 isolated from Cinnamonomi cortex (the bark of Cinnamomum cassia Blume) in the rat plasma. This method used a TSK- GEL ODS-80TS column, two solvents (A: 0.01% acetic acid; B: methanol with 0.01 % acetic acid) in a linear gradient at a flow-rate of 1.0 ml/min, and fluorescence detection at excitation and emission wavelengths of 220 and 327 nm.",
